How does an impulse travel from one neuron to another?
Mazyrski [523]

Answer:

When a nerve impulse reaches the end of an axon, the axon releases chemicals called neurotransmitters. Neurotransmitters travel across the synapse between the axon and the dendrite of the next neuron.

Explanation:

The binding allows the nerve impulse to travel through the receiving neuron.

How people often take vitamins needlessly or in excess, resulting in excretion in urine of water-soluble vitamins and potentiall
Katyanochek1 [597]

Water-soluble vitamin excesses are swiftly eliminated in urine and infrequently build up to hazardous amounts.

What is water-soluble vitamins ?

The B vitamins — folate, thiamine, riboflavin, niacin, pantothenic acid, biotin, vitamin B6, and vitamin B12 — and vitamin C are the nine water-soluble vitamins. A clinical condition caused by a deficiency in one or more of these water-soluble vitamins can have serious morbidity and death effects.

The fat-soluble vitamins are used by your body as needed, and any extra is stored in your tissues and organs. The risk of vitamin poisoning increases when you take too much fat-soluble vitamins on a regular basis, making them more dangerous than water-soluble vitamins.

The power to arrest someone who refuses to undergo treatment for a communicable disease lies with:
Phoenix [80]

a local health officer

The power to arrest someone who refuses to undergo treatment for a communicable disease lies with: a local health officer.

A local health officer is an individual who works with a local health department (a government agency). A local health officer is responsible for the enforcement of all public health laws, and regulations. He is also responsible for controlling, organizing, and administering all duties and operations of the health department, inclusive of the operation of laboratories, clinics, and health centers.
